What exactly is a demon?
Prior to this, Chen Xu held a universal concept that demons should be birds and beasts that had developed sentience, intelligence, and magical powers.
Just like the rat demon Ashi and Ninth Master, or the hedgehog demon Wei Yuan.
According to local legends, demons are untamed and often commit evil.
So far, the demons Chen Xu has encountered include the two affectionate and righteous rat demons, the self-disciplined and polite hedgehog demon Wei Yuan, and the eagle demon who is just beginning to develop intelligence...
None of them were evil.
Even the fox demon Hu Xi, whose righteousness and evil are hard to discern, is actually practicing cultivation seriously, seeking transcendence, and pursuing the Great Dao.
It is evident that demons who develop intelligence are not much different from humans.
Humans can be good or evil, and so can demons.
Evil demons certainly exist, but we cannot condemn all demons in one fell swoop.
But now, Chen Xu has heard of another kind of demon.
Inflammation!
It doesn't seem to be a beast that has become a demon, but rather something like a spirit or monster that naturally arises from the heavens and earth.
Feng Yuanbo explained: "People often think that birds, beasts, plants and trees that become spirits are demons, and that is not wrong."
However, in the minds of spiritual practitioners, demons are actually a general term for different kinds of beings.
If a coffin lid becomes a spirit, it's a coffin demon; if a ship becomes a spirit, it's a ship demon; if a painting becomes a spirit, it's a painting demon...
But this is not all that demons have to offer.
Sometimes, natural disasters can also turn into demons. Calamity can soar to the sky and cause droughts, floods, epidemics, etc.
Drought is the fire spirit, flood is the abyss, earthquake is the earth rumbling old man, and plague and miasma are known as the Nine Bones Goddess.
These are the great demons in the disaster, and besides these great demons, there are also various lesser demons.
For example, if the drought worsens, it will inevitably be accompanied by locust demons, such as the ominous Sui Xiong Tong, Kuroyukihime, and Yan Chi Shi.
Many of the monsters in natural disasters are irrational; they only destroy, devour, and invade.
The Taoist school's policy of exterminating demons and monsters is often based on the idea that such calamities arise from demons.
However, Confucius followed the example of Yao and Shun, where all things flourished together without harming one another;
Xunzi said, "Nourish the mountains and forests of the state, the marshes and vegetation, the fish and turtles, and all kinds of fish and turtles, and prohibit their release at the appropriate times..."
